It's not India's fault that the f***s in charge changed the whole ODI game after India won the world cup in 2011.. They f*****g introduced playing with 2 new balls... and you wonder why the scoring has gone up dramatically! Its not just in India, but also in England, NZ, SA, Australia etc...

It's utter b****** that SC teams have quietly agreed to this new ODI setup which greatly hinders their strength, which is spin bowling with the slightly older ball. It has also more or less eliminated possible reverse swing. Previously we would see spinners able to contain & pick up wickets in the middle overs, but now with the harder ball, wtf do we see?? Two hard new balls ALL match ...flying to all corners on flat odi pitches..
